Step 1: Check Your Router’s Settings
Before we dive into the troubleshooting process, let’s start by checking your router’s settings. This will give us an idea of what devices are connected to your network and what their IP addresses are.
- Router Settings: Log in to your router’s web interface using the default IP address (usually 192.168.0.1 or 192.168.1.1). You can find this information on the router’s packaging or on the manufacturer’s website.
- IP Address: Look for the IP address of your router. This is usually displayed in the router’s settings or in the router’s documentation.
- Device List: Check the device list on your router to see what devices are connected to your network. You can usually find this information in the router’s settings or in the device list.
